Brief Description
The Manufacturing Engineer performs a variety of engineering tasks to develop, test, implement, and document manufacturing processes and methods. The work is done both on the production floor and in an office setting, and it is completed in accordance with product specifications, customer requirements, quality standards, and all required governmental laws and safety standards.
Essential Functions
Troubleshoots routine to moderately complex production problems involving continuous manufacturing processes, investigates root causes, and recommends countermeasures.
Conducts routine to moderately complex engineering trials and production process evaluations, analyzes production data, identifies trends and improvement opportunities, and recommends process adjustments to improve product quality and manufacturing efficiency while reducing material and manpower costs.
Creates, writes, and maintains standard work instructions.
Develops, tests, implements, and documents manufacturing processes for new and existing parts and/or products.
Prepares training materials and trains key production employees and supervisors on new work procedures and manufacturing processes.
Examines manufacturing processes for cost‑reducing automation opportunities and leads implementation of approved projects.
Supports existing factory automation, including software, controls, mechanical and hydraulic systems.
Estimates manufacturing costs, process time, and manpower requirements and consolidates, documents, and presents results for review.
Conducts research, compiles data, prepares reports, and delivers presentations.

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ities
Bachelor’s degree in engineering with 4+ years of post‑graduate experience in a continuous process manufacturing engineering environment.
Equivalent combination of education and experience may be used to satisfy the requisite qualifications of the job.
Must possess the ability to draft in 3D; SolidWorks experience preferred.
Working knowledge of the practical application of engineering science and technology to the production of various products.
Working knowledge of production processes, quality control, costs, and other techniques for maximizing the effective manufacture of goods.
Very good analytical, problem‑solving, communication, and presentation skills; strong math skills; intermediate skills in Excel and other application software used in production of technical plans, blueprints, drawings and models.
Programming and robotic experience preferred but not required.
Demonstrates the ability to safely work with basic hand tools or machining equipment.
